tahini

Snack foods; Nuts & seeds

A thick paste made of ground sesame seed. Popular in the Middle East in a number of specialties, including "hummus" and "babghanoush".

sesame seed

Snack foods; Nuts & seeds

A tiny, flat seed with a nutty, slightly sweet flavor used in breads, cakes, confections, cookies, pastries, and salads. This seed was used at least as far back as 3,000 B. C. in Assyria.

safflower seed

Snack foods; Nuts & seeds

The seeds of the safflower plant, used to yield a low-cholesterol oil used in cooking oils and margarines.

psyllium

Snack foods; Nuts & seeds

A plant, also known as "fleawort," that is valued for its high fiber content. The powdered seeds of this plant are often used as a laxative.
